Welcome Home to SW Las Vegas Communities:  Maravilla at Mountain's Edge

Maravilla at Mountains Edge is a subdivision in the growing Master Planned Community of Mountain's Edge tucked near the mountains in Southwest Las Vegas near the corner of Durango & Pyle.

The home style is hard for me to describe as I believe it is a style in the Eastern end of the US.  Alleys provide access to your garages so the front of the homes have outline character and detail without the unsightly view of a garage.  All front yards are required to have desert landscaping (no grass).  Most of the private yards (not all) are courtyard or patio style so these homes may be a perfect fit for someone who is looking for a detached home without all the high maintenance of a large yard.

There are currently 417 single family detached homes in Miravilla at Mountain's Edge ranging from 1480-2471 square feet.

Renee, this style home is called 'neo traditional' and in Florida, the homes are mostly low country style with porches across the front and built with Hardy board to look like wood siding. The design was started in Seaside, a town in the Panhandle, designed by an architect from Miami and spread to Celebration, Disney's town in Kissimmee near Disney World. Baldwin Park in Orlando copycatted Celebration. We have a little bit of neo traditional here in Jacksonville, but not an entire town concept like Celebration or Baldwin Park where there are downtown streets, shops, etc. The lots are small and there are parks and green areas in front of the homes. They are beautiful and look like the old fashioned home towns of our dreams and yesteryear. The architecture is pre-WWII. Yours is probably Mediterranean architecture? But it's very refreshing not to see a garage on a narrow house/lot. Also, the garages often have garage apartments and in Celebration and Baldwin Park they can be rented out - they have a separate address.
